Default Windows 7 Install Issues

I am doing a fresh install of Windows 7 from a burned image. The install stops at expanding files @ 70% and eventually bombs out.

I have formatted the drive multiple times, tried removing memory modules, and I guess the next step is reburning the ISO.

Has anyone else had this issue, if so what did you do to fix it?

It is going over an XP install, but it has been reformatted. So, it is fresh.
